Course Details
- Financial Planning for Startups – Understanding the primary financial considerations and strategies for startup businesses, including budgeting, forecasting, and financial modeling.
- Sources of Startup Financing – Identifying and evaluating various sources of funding for startups, including angel investors, venture capital, crowdfunding, and small business loans.
- Financial Statements & Analysis for Startups – Creating and analyzing financial statements, such as income statements, balance sheets, and cash flow statements, to assess the financial health and performance of a startup.
- Financial Metrics &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) for Startups – Measuring and tracking financial metrics and KPIs, such as burn rate, runway, customer acquisition cost, and lifetime value, to make informed business decisions.
- Building a Financial Model for a Startup – Developing a financial model using spreadsheet software to project revenue, expenses, and cash flow for a startup.
- Financial Negotiations for Startups – Understanding the legal and financial aspects of financial negotiations, such as term sheets, investment agreements, and convertible notes, and negotiating with investors and lenders.
- Navigating Regulatory & Compliance Requirements for Startups – Complying with various financial regulations and requirements, such as securities laws, tax laws, and financial reporting standards, for startups.
- Raising Capital for Startups – Preparing and executing a successful capital raise, including creating a compelling pitch deck, identifying potential investors, and managing the due diligence process.
- Financial Management for Growing Startups – Managing the financial aspects of a growing startup, including cash flow management, financial planning, and budgeting for growth.
